Description
The Mosaic Florida Kingsnake, Lampropeltis getula floridana, is a beautiful pattern variation known for its intricate, speckled mix of black, yellow, and cream markings. This hardy, adaptable colubrid reaches an adult size of 3 to 4 feet and thrives in secure terrestrial enclosures with proper temperature gradients. Renowned for their docile temperament and strong feeding response, these snakes make excellent subjects for intermediate reptile keepers.
Species: Lampropeltis getula floridana
Family: Colubridae
Origin: Southeastern United States
Adult Size: 3–4 feet
Diet: Rodents
Temperament: Hardy and adaptable
Activity Level: Terrestrial
Enclosure Requirement: Secure with heat gradient
